Kapahi (80)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Kapahi (80) Village has a population of 249 (249) with 114 (114) males and 135 (135) females.The sex ratio in Kapahi (80) is 1185,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Kapahi (80) Village is 23 (23) which is 9.24% of Kapahi (80)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Kapahi (80) Village is 1091 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Kapahi (80) village is listed as part of the Dharmpur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Mandi District in the state of HIMACHAL PRADESH in INDIA.

Kapahi (80) Literacy Rate
Kapahi (80) Village has a literacy rate of 79.65%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Kapahi (80) Village is 88.35 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Kapahi (80) Village is 72.36 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Kapahi (80)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Kapahi (80) Village is 32 (32) with 14 (14) males and 18 (18) females, which is 12.85% of Kapahi (80)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1286 females for every 1000 males.
Kapahi (80)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es Population in Kapahi (80)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Kapahi (80) Village.

Kapahi (80)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Kapahi (80) Village, there are about 151 (151) workers, making up nearly 60.64% of the Kapahi (80) Village total population. Out of these, around 55 (55) are male workers, and about 96 (96) are female workers.
